Transaction 8758edfdf93dcbf058e68d62d9c9e69819eb6a9a2a0c5396dca2f116e407ca5d

1 Input
2 Outputs
  • 8758edfdf93dcbf058e68d62d9c9e69819eb6a9a2a0c5396dca2f116e407ca5d:0
  • value  66143
    address  3PWYi6PtM21Nk2FXwtMNRRns3K9DhQA9on
  • 8758edfdf93dcbf058e68d62d9c9e69819eb6a9a2a0c5396dca2f116e407ca5d:1
  • value  2283176
    address  142m7nRLZHRpJiKi7241eY2UJ4FjDkgrbK